Procedures
When you join the CCH family, we have standard practices for the safety of all concerned. We enter your home and desire only the best experiences for you, your family, and your furry friends.
Each team member has previous experience working with animals of all sorts and has been fully vetted to serve you and your fur family! All team members receive training in first aid and pet CPR as part of our onboarding process.
We train each member for thirty (30) hours of on-the-job training, allowing them to work with your family. Additionally, ten (10) hours of continuing education are required annually.
Booking Policy
We love caring for your pets and want to make sure every visit is safe, calm, and well-planned. To help us do that, we ask for a little advance notice when scheduling services.
For Existing Clients
We kindly ask that bookings be requested at least 24-48 hours in advance.
While we’ll always do our best to accommodate last-minute requests, bookings made with less than 24 hours’ notice may be subject to availability.
For New Clients
To get started with us, new clients need a minimum of 7 days’ advance notice to request a service or reservation.
Before confirming any booking, we’ll need:
A completed pet profile and required documentation uploaded to PetPocketBook
A successful meet and greet, so everyone (pets included!) feels comfortable and confident.
Services and reservations can be confirmed once all onboarding steps are completed.

We have a few requirements when loving those furry friends.
All animals must have resided in your home for 10 weeks. This is done for your furry friend’s best interest.
Special needs of pets must be made known before any bookings are made.
All animals must be 10 weeks old and weaned from their mother.
Before we can assist you with pet care needs, proof of all necessary vaccines for your pet is required. Special circumstances will be taken on a case-by-case basis.
